**Day 1 — Basement archive induction.** Locate archive room B3, lower level, past the loading corridor. Night access only via stairwell C; lifts lock at 22:00. Sign the log on entry and exit. Lights are motion-timed — wave at the sensor if they cut out. Do not remove files without a slip from the duty lead. Door keypad is left of the frame; use this code:

door code, yagap-bahof: bdg-O-05

Re: snapshot tests for the Wrenboard component library — the diffs are flaky because the render harness races the font loader. Don't bump retry counts blindly; that just hides real regressions. Gate the snapshot capture behind a settle check instead, and keep the pixel tolerance tight or the Marlowe theme changes will slip through unnoticed. All knobs live in one place so on-call can tune without a redeploy; they are defined below.

tuning constants:
QUOTAS = {
    "druwyn": 5,
    "holix": 5,
    "zorath": 5,
    "holwyn": 10,
}

// Max concurrent transcode slots per worker on the Reelbarn farm.
// Security folks: this also bounds how many untrusted input files a
// single sandbox handles at once, so treat changes as a threat-model
// update, not a perf tweak. We learned that the hard way after the
// Oakmere incident, where a crafted container header pivoted between
// jobs sharing a slot. Any change requires re-running the sandbox
// escape suite against the hardened image identified below.

build token for kagaf-hahof: htk14_9d3d4d26d7d8de

## Configuration

The Tumblecrate locker flow works like this: a resident scans a code, the service reserves a locker, and the door controller gets a one-shot unlock command. Reservation TTL and locker pool size are both plain env settings and safe to tune. The door controller, however, authenticates every unlock request, so the service's env file must include its signing credential. Append this line:

vault entry, hawip-bahif: COURIER_KEY20=0cc4378a8ab04bccc3fd